MWA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

229 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Mueller Water Products (MWA)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$1.77B — up 8% from $1.64B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 29 funds opened new MWA positions and 16 closed out — a net gain of 13 holders — while 82 added to existing stakes and 76 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Victory Capital Management, adding an estimated $22.4M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, cutting an estimated $26.2M.
